logo

Output 81df51640ba89fb43c692720abe7416153c41876caa1cd196c82d0c77a01df5a:1

value
2333980
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4f853013ffbdbf8a12a292df7df9edcc04004811 OP_EQUALVERIFY OP_CHECKSIG
address
18FTwCvSLm5XzACPWpUdYqUB1xdK4oCwJq
transaction
81df51640ba89fb43c692720abe7416153c41876caa1cd196c82d0c77a01df5a